Understanding Cast Iron Pipe Rust

Cast iron pipes have long been a staple in plumbing systems, especially in older homes and historic buildings. However, over time, this durable material can succumb to rust, leading to serious structural damage and potential health hazards. Understanding the causes of cast iron pipe rust is the first step in effective repair.
Rust forms when iron comes into contact with oxygen and moisture, creating a chemical reaction that weakens the pipe’s integrity. In many cases, cast iron pipes buried beneath the ground or exposed to corrosive water sources are particularly vulnerable. Restoring historic cast iron buildings often involves addressing these rusted sections through specialized cast iron pipe repair techniques. Identifying leaks in cast iron plumbing is crucial, as persistent moisture can accelerate rust formation, necessitating prompt restoration efforts to preserve both the pipes and the overall plumbing system’s efficiency.
Assessment: Scope and Severity of Damage

Before tackling any cast iron pipe repair, it’s crucial to assess the scope and severity of the damage. This initial step is vital for determining the best methods for repairing cast iron pipes, as well as guiding decisions on how to stop cast iron pipe leaks. Inspecting the affected area involves carefully examining the extent of corrosion, rust buildup, and any visible cracks or breaks in the pipe’s structure. Severe cases might require complete replacement, while less extensive damage could be repaired by casting new parts for old cast iron pipes, a process that offers both efficiency and longevity.
Understanding the extent of deterioration is also key to preventing future leaks. Identifying weak spots, pitting, or signs of structural compromise allows homeowners and plumbers to address these issues proactively. This proactive approach not only saves time and money but also ensures the continued reliability and safety of plumbing systems, minimizing the risk of water damage and potential health hazards often associated with rusted out pipes.

Advanced Technologies in Cast Iron Repair

In the realm of cast iron pipe repair, advanced technologies are revolutionizing the way we tackle this age-old problem. Gone are the days when complete replacement was the only option for rusted-out cast iron pipes. Today, innovative methods offer sustainable and cost-effective solutions for repairing these essential plumbing components. One such game-changer is laser welding, which allows for precise, non-invasive repairs, extending the lifespan of these pipes without the need for extensive excavation.
Additionally, advanced coating systems have emerged as a powerful tool in protecting against future rust formation. These coatings create a protective barrier on the pipe’s surface, preventing water and oxygen from coming into direct contact with vulnerable metal. By combining these modern techniques with traditional methods, repairing cast iron pipes has become more accessible, efficient, and durable than ever before, ensuring a robust infrastructure for years to come.
Maintenance Tips to Prevent Future Rusting

Regular maintenance is key to preventing future rusting of cast iron pipes. One effective method is to periodically inspect your pipes for any signs of damage or corrosion, addressing issues immediately before they escalate. Applying a thin layer of mineral oil or pipe wax can create a protective barrier against moisture and oxygen, which are the primary contributors to rust formation. Additionally, flushing your plumbing system with clean water on a regular basis helps remove any stagnant water that might have accumulated in hard-to-reach areas, reducing the risk of corrosion.
For existing rusted pipes, understanding the process of restoring cast iron water lines is crucial. While some DIY methods can temporarily seal cast iron pipes, permanent solutions like specialized sealing compounds or epoxy coatings offer more durable repairs. These advanced techniques not only stop further rusting but also provide an extra layer of protection, ensuring the longevity of your plumbing system.
